Job description
SpaceX was founded under the belief that a future where humanity is out exploring the stars is fundamentally more exciting than one where we are not. Today SpaceX is actively developing the technologies to make this possible, with the ultimate goal of enabling human life on Mars. FIRMWARE ENGINEER RESPONSIBILITIES:
- Develop, integrate, and maintain software on both existing and next-generation satellite modems
- Collaborate with Modem ASIC and networking teams to deliver the best performing modem into our satellite and consumer terminal products
- Design and develop system emulators and test harnesses for system level verification
- Assist in lab PCB bring-up and low-level board testing/debugging
- Be the point of contact for the modem team to the overall platform integration team
Requirements
- Bachelor of Science degree in electrical engineering, computer science, or computer engineering
- 5+ years of direct experience in C/C++ programming, and shell scripting such as PERL, AWK, SED, BASH.
- 3+ years experience in building firmware and system testbeds
